Lack of p53 augments thymoquinone-induced apoptosis and caspase activation in human osteosarcoma cells
1 Feb 2007
Abstract excerpt
We have recently shown that thymoquinone (TQ) is an antineoplastic drug that induces p53-dependent apoptosis in human colon cancer cells. This study evaluated the antiproliferative and pro-apoptotic effects of TQ in two human osteosarcoma cell lines with different p53 mutation status.
